By Clarencia Cynrae on September 21st, 2009Karla Leanne Homolka, aka Karla Leanne Teale, was a Canadian former convict. Teale Homolka was tried and convicted for raping and murdering two teens from Ontario, Canada. Homolka was implicated for manslaughter of Leslie Mahaffy and Kristen French. Karla was also tried for raping and killing her sister, Tammy Homolka.
Karla Homolka said she was not an active participant in the crimes.
Karla Homolka struck a bargain with her prosecutor to plead guilty. In return, she would be given a relatively short prison sentence of 12 years. Homolka was arrested, charged and convicted in 1991.
Homolka’s husband, Paul Bernardo, bore the brunt of the murder charges for the deaths of Leslie Mahaffy, Kristen French and Tammy Homolka. Bernardo was arrested in 1993 and convicted in 1995. Canada gave Bernardo the maximum sentence allowed, which was life in prison.
Karla Homolka was convicted and jailed for 12 years from 1993 onwards. Homolka was freed in 2005 and has relocated to Paris or Antilles. Homolka had a new partner and baby by the time she allegedly left Canada in 2007.
Homolka was very lucky to have struck her plea bargain before video tape evidence was found against her. Video recordings showed Homolka participating in the rapes and murders of the young female victims. The public was outraged but a deal was a deal and Homolka was freed in 2005.
